A visitor guide for a downtown area lists many restaurants. Which of the following is an example of a quantitative variable the guide could report for each restaurant? A. the zip code of the restaurant B. the number of seats in the restaurant C. the type of cuisine the restaurant offers D. a restaurant critic’s letter grade (A–F)

Answers

The correct answer is B. The number of seats in the restaurant

Explanation:

The number of seats is a quantitative variable because this is expressed using numbers and can be understood through numbers.  For example, the average of seats in the restaurants in the area can be calculated by finding the total of seats and dividing the number into the number of restaurants.

On the other hand, the type of cuisine and the restaurant critic's letter grade do not involve numbers but qualities, which make them qualitative variables. Also, even if zip codes are expressed using numbers these cannot be understood through them, for example, you cannot add two zip codes.

Assume the random variable x is normally distributed with mean and standard deviation . Find the indicated probability.

Answers

Complete Question

Assume the random variable x is normally distributed with mean u=87 and standard deviation o=5. Find the indicated probability.

P(x<81)

P(x<81)=__(Round to four decimal places).

Answer:

The  value  is  [tex]P(x < 81) = 0.11507[/tex]

Step-by-step explanation:

From the question we are told that

  The mean is  [tex]\mu = 87[/tex]

  The  standard deviation is  [tex]\sigma = 5[/tex]

The probability is mathematically represented as

              [tex]P(x < 81) = P (\frac{X - \mu }{\sigma } < \frac{81 - 87 }{5 } )[/tex]

Generally  [tex]\frac{X - \mu}{\sigma} = Z (The \ z-score \ of X )[/tex]

            [tex]P(x < 81) = P (Z < - 1.2)[/tex]

From the z-table  

                   [tex]P (Z < - 1.2) = 0.11507[/tex]

So               [tex]P(x < 81) = 0.11507[/tex]
